Indian-Origin 11-Year-Old Girl Creats Record in UK Chess

Indian-origin chess prodigy Bodhana Sivanandan has created history by becoming the top-ranked female chess player in England at just 11 years old. The North London student holds a FIDE rating of 2366 and recently surpassed four-time British women’s champion Lan Yao. She has also entered the world’s top 100 female players, currently ranked 72nd globally.
